AI Investment Analysis of SailPoint, Inc. (SAIL) Stock

Strategic Position

SailPoint Technologies Holdings, Inc. (SAIL) is a leading provider of enterprise identity governance solutions. The company specializes in identity security, helping organizations manage and secure user access across hybrid IT environments. SailPoint's core products include IdentityIQ and IdentityNow, which offer identity governance, access management, and compliance solutions. The company serves a diverse client base, including Fortune 500 companies, and competes with firms like Okta, CyberArk, and ForgeRock. SailPoint's competitive advantage lies in its AI-driven identity governance platform, which automates access controls and reduces security risks.

Financial Strengths

  • Revenue Drivers: IdentityIQ and IdentityNow are the primary revenue drivers, with subscription-based services contributing significantly to recurring revenue.
  • Profitability: SailPoint has demonstrated strong gross margins, typically above 70%, reflecting its software-centric business model. The company has also shown consistent revenue growth, though profitability has been impacted by R&D and sales investments.
  • Partnerships: SailPoint collaborates with major cloud providers like AWS and Microsoft Azure to integrate its identity solutions with their platforms.

Innovation

SailPoint invests heavily in AI and machine learning to enhance its identity governance capabilities. The company holds multiple patents related to identity security and automation.

Key Risks

  • Regulatory: SailPoint operates in a highly regulated industry, with compliance requirements such as GDPR and CCPA posing ongoing challenges.
  • Competitive: The identity governance market is crowded, with strong competitors like Okta and CyberArk, which could pressure SailPoint's market share.
  • Financial: SailPoint has historically operated at a net loss due to high operating expenses, though it maintains positive cash flow from operations.
  • Operational: The company's transition to a subscription-based model may face execution risks, including customer adoption and revenue recognition timing.

Future Outlook

  • Growth Strategies: SailPoint is focusing on expanding its SaaS offerings (IdentityNow) and leveraging AI to differentiate its platform. The company also aims to grow its international presence.
  • Catalysts: Upcoming earnings reports and potential contract wins with large enterprises could serve as near-term catalysts.
  • Long Term Opportunities: Increasing demand for identity security due to rising cyber threats and cloud adoption presents a significant growth opportunity for SailPoint.

Investment Verdict

SailPoint is well-positioned in the growing identity governance market, with strong technology and a recurring revenue model. However, competition and profitability challenges pose risks. Investors should monitor the company's ability to scale its SaaS offerings and achieve sustained profitability.
